Q: Is 38,521,681 a Prime Number?
A: No, 38,521,681 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 38521681 can be evenly divided by 1 11 121 241 1,321 2,651 14,531 29,161 159,841 318,361 3,501,971 and 38,521,681, with no remainder.
Since 38,521,681 cannot be divided by just 1 and 38,521,681, it is not a prime number.
